I've had the regular AP since 2004 and enjoy the convenience of heading over whenever. But as others have said, I see things differently now than when I was a tourist. The biggest problem I have is crowds. I just don't have the patience to go when its really busy since I've done everything. Sometimes I run over for 2-3 hours and then come home...that's a nice thing to be able to do...you know? ;)
